Why should you support me?
• In Australia, there are around 5 new cases of type 1 diabetes diagnosed every day and the incidence is increasing.
• Unlike type 2 diabetes, type 1 has nothing to do with diet or lifestyle and cannot be prevented.
• The long-term complications of the disease can include blindness, heart disease, kidney failure, and even amputation.
• People with type 1 diabetes need up to six insulin injections every day, just to stay alive.
• Insulin is not a cure for type 1 diabetes – currently there is no cure. That's why I am Riding. Your donation will fund vital research, which will one day find a cure for type 1 diabetes.
